Kanawha County real estate Market Report.

Information and statistics on the latest trends in the Kanawha County real estate market, updated for June 2025. *

The typical home value in Kanawha County is projected to be $196,880 for the month of May. April’s finalized data reported the typical value of a home in the county to be $194,250—up 21.44% over the previous 12 months. For comparison, state-level data pegged home values at $247,600 in West Virginia for the most recent reporting period. That number is expected to float around $249,050 in May.

Kanawha County had 160 new listings and 139 listings that went under contract in April, increasing the area’s total available inventory to 198—up 1.54% from the previous month. Inventory is projected to have further increased in May.

Of those 198 active listings, 31.31% reduced their price in the month of April. The median listing price for homes in Kanawha County grew 4.38% from March to April, bringing the current median listing price to $180,000. Based on projected data for May, listing prices may continue to grow.

The number of days that homes have been on the market prior to going under contract rose year-over-year. In April 2025, the median time for a listed property to go pending was 11 days, compared to -43 days in April 2024. In recent months the median number of days from listed to pending appears to be increasing. That trend is predicted to have carried through to this May.

Kanawha County offers residents a vibrant blend of cultural attractions, outdoor adventures, and community events that enrich everyday life.

Kanawha County is where urban convenience meets the breathtaking scenery of the Appalachian foothills, offering residents a unique blend of city amenities and outdoor adventure. At the heart of the county is Charleston, the largest city in the state, where you’ll find the impressive West Virginia State Capitol and the rich cultural experiences of Clay Center for the Arts & Sciences. Strolling riverside after dinner along the Kanawha River, or catching live music at Haddad Riverfront Park, you’ll quickly notice a tight-knit community spirit.

Education is a top priority here, with Kanawha County Schools providing a robust network of public schools and specialty programs. Families appreciate the recreational opportunities at Coonskin Park and the fascinating displays at West Virginia State Museum. Neighborhoods like South Charleston deliver everything from independent boutiques to beloved local dining spots, while St. Albans charms with walkable streets and proximity to scenic river trails.

For commuters, well-connected highways make travel easy, whether you’re exploring surrounding counties or heading toward the picturesque ridges that shape Kanawha’s horizon.
